Understanding the Audi Q3's Key Features

Before diving into the specifics, let's clarify some essential terms. The 'quattro' in the Audi Q3's name refers to its all-wheel-drive system, which provides better traction and stability, especially in challenging weather conditions. The 'S tronic' is Audi's dual-clutch automatic transmission, known for its smooth and quick gear changes. The 'TFSI' stands for Turbocharged Fuel Stratified Injection, a technology that enhances engine efficiency and performance.

The Audi Q3 is powered by a 2.0-liter turbocharged engine, producing 190 horsepower. This engine is paired with a 7-speed S tronic automatic transmission, offering a seamless driving experience. The Q3's compact size and agile handling make it ideal for urban environments, while its robust engine ensures it can handle highway speeds with ease.

Performance and Practicality

The Audi Q3's performance is impressive for a compact SUV. It acc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h (0 to 62 mph) in just 7.3 seconds, making it quick off the line. Its top speed is 222 km/h (137.94 mph), which is more than sufficient for most driving scenarios. The Q3's fuel efficiency is also noteworthy, with a combined consumption of 7.6-8.5 liters per 100 km (30.95 - 27.67 US mpg).

In terms of practicality, the Q3 offers a spacious interior with seating for five and a generous trunk space of 530 liters, expandable to 1525 liters with the rear seats folded. This makes it suitable for families or anyone needing extra cargo space. The Q3's towing capacity of 2000 kg (4409.25 lbs) with brakes is another plus for those who need to haul trailers or boats.

Suitability for Different Lifestyles

City Driving: The Q3's compact dimensions (4484 mm in length) and responsive handling make it perfect for city driving. Its all-wheel-drive system provides added confidence in wet or slippery conditions.

Long-Distance Travel: With its comfortable seating and advanced infotainment system, the Q3 is well-suited for long road trips. The fuel efficiency and large fuel tank (60 liters) mean fewer stops for refueling.

Family Use: The spacious interior and ample trunk space make the Q3 a great choice for families. Safety features like ABS and multiple airbags add peace of mind.

Single Ownership: For singles or couples, the Q3 offers a blend of luxury and practicality. Its stylish design and premium features make it a desirable choice.

Adventure Lifestyles: While not a hardcore off-roader, the Q3's all-wheel-drive system and decent ground clearance make it capable of handling light off-road adventures.

AttributeDetails
GenerationQ3 (F3)
Modification (Engine)40 TFSI (190 Hp) quattro S tronic
Powertrain ArchitectureInternal Combustion engine
Body TypeSUV
Seats5
Doors5
Combined Fuel Consumption7.6-8.5 l/100 km
CO2 Emissions172-193 g/km
Fuel TypePetrol (Gasoline)
Acceleration (0-100 km/h)7.3 sec
Maximum Speed222 km/h
Emission StandardEuro 6d-ISC-FCM
Engine Displacement1984 cm3
Number of Cylinders4
Engine ConfigurationInline
Power Output190 Hp
Torque320 Nm
Compression Ratio12.2:1
Fuel Injection SystemDirect injection
Engine AspirationTurbocharger, Intercooler
Kerb Weight1620 kg
Max Load540-580 kg
Trunk Space (Minimum and Maximum)530 l / 1525 l
Fuel Tank Capacity60 l
Length4484 mm
Width1856 mm
Height1616 mm
Wheelbase2680 mm
Drive Wheel SystemAll wheel drive (4x4)
Number of Gears (Transmission Type)7 gears, automatic transmission S tronic
Front SuspensionIndependent, type McPherson with coil spring and anti-roll bar
Rear SuspensionIndependent multi-link spring suspension with stabilizer
Front BrakesVentilated discs
Rear BrakesDisc
Assisting SystemsABS (Anti-lock braking system)
Power SteeringElectric Steering
Tire Size215/65 R17; 235/55 R18; 235/50 R19; 255/45 R19; 255/40 R20
Wheel Rims Size6.5J x 17; 7J x 17; 7J x 18; 7J x 19; 8.5J x 19; 8.5J x 20
